1. Motor Power – Is It Strong Enough for Your Material?

The motor wattage and RPM directly impact a machine’s ability to cut clean grooves across dense flooring materials like PVC, rubber, or vinyl.

What to Look For:

  • 1000W–1200W for commercial-grade work

  • 13,000 RPM for high-speed, smooth cutting

  • Consistent performance on thick materials

2. Cutting Depth Adjustment – Can You Adapt to Each Floor Type?

A grooving machine must accommodate different flooring thicknesses. Fixed-depth groovers limit flexibility and may lead to weak welds or damage.

What to Look For:

  • Adjustable depth 0–4.5 mm

  • On-the-fly adjustment without tools

  • Easy-to-read dial system

3. Auto-Leveling – Can It Handle Uneven or Bumpy Floors?

Uneven subfloors are common—even in new builds. A rigid machine will dig too deep or float too high, ruining groove consistency.

What to Look For:

  • Auto-leveling floating blade

  • Real-time micro-adjustments

  • Stable cutting regardless of floor imperfections

4. Blade Maintenance – How Quick Is the Swap?

Dull blades are inevitable. But downtime shouldn’t be. A good machine should allow fast and easy blade changes without a technician.

What to Look For:

  • Tool-free blade access

  • Easy-to-clean housing

  • Reliable supply of original replacement blades

5. Safety & Ergonomics – Is It Built for Daily Use?

Installers use these machines for hours. Without vibration damping or safety guards, operator fatigue and injury risks skyrocket.

What to Look For:

  • Anti-vibration frame

  • Blade guards and electrical safety

  • Lightweight body with ergonomic handle
